Connecticut has a seat belt law which I vehemently oppose. I remember when then Governor William O'Neill signed this bill into law. The proposal of the seat belt law in Connecticut caused a HUGE controversy. Most citizens were loudly and vociferously opposed to it. In order to get the bill passed in the legislature O'Neill and proponents of the bill PROMISED the public "This law will NEVER be enforced primarily as a stand alone infraction. There will NEVER be police staring into your car solely to check for seat belts. The only time someone will get a ticket for not using their safety harness is when stopped for another infraction." Back then, SENSIBLE citizens (True, Constitution loving Americans.) abhorred even the IDEA of police standing on the side of the road looking into your car!
How far we have fallen... That promise has turned into police making road blocks that in themselves are safety hazards - Solely to enable them to look inside your car.
